Clock skew. Several Larkspine build agents drifted up to 40 seconds apart after the NTP relay in the Oxbow rack was decommissioned. Artifacts signed on a fast agent look future-dated to a slow one, and verification rejects them. We've repointed all agents at the new Tern time service and added a skew check to the preflight script. If an agent exceeds 5 seconds of drift, it's pulled from rotation automatically. To re-enroll a quarantined agent, you'll need the recovery passphrase below.

unlock words, bagaf-yahog: istwyn-gilox

Hi all,

I'm handing release duties for Lattice, our school timetable solver, to the incoming team. The cadence is monthly, aligned with term planning at our pilot districts. Before each release, run the full constraint-regression suite; solver output differences must be triaged, never waved through, since schools depend on stable schedules. Artifacts are built in CI and must be signed before upload to the distribution bucket. For verification, the release signing key you will use is the following.

deploy key for kajof-fajop: bky6_gDHw9Q

## Signing the Eventspine Schema Registry Releases

All schema bundles published to the Eventspine registry must be signed before promotion. The registry rejects unsigned manifests at ingest. Build the bundle with `spine pack`, then sign with the release pipeline's attached identity. Do not sign locally; CI handles it. Verify the signature with `spine verify` before tagging. Rotation happens quarterly; stale signatures block consumer sync jobs. For verification in downstream environments, use the public signing key below.

release key, hadug-kawef: bky13_mPGeFZeR1GZ1G